Package: live-build

Version: 1:20230502



steps to reproduce:

1) make a clean install of Debian 12

2) install the live-build package from the normal repository

3) run "lb config" to create a build tree

expected behavior: tree for bookworm should be made

actual: tree for bullseye is made by default


stage 2:

remove created files, then run:

lb config -d bookworm

to force generation for an appropriat distro


then run lb build

expected: build should complete successfully.

actual: build fails with the following error message:

E: Package 'firmware-linux' has no installation candidate


as I know, this bug is fixed already in newer versions of live-build, but the packaged version is not updated to get this fix, which is expected to be done through the updates channel.
